What are Cryptocurrency Trends?

In any market, a "trend" is a general direction in which prices are moving. Identifying trends in crypto is crucial for making informed trading decisions. Trends aren't always straight lines; they can be upwards (a "bull market"), downwards (a "bear market"), or move sideways (a "consolidation" period). Emerging trends represent new technologies, growing adoption, or shifts in investor sentiment. Understanding these trends can potentially help you identify promising opportunities.

Key Emerging Trends

Here are some of the most significant trends shaping the cryptocurrency market right now:

  • **Real World Assets (RWA) Tokenization:** Traditionally, assets like real estate, stocks, and commodities are difficult to divide and trade. Tokenization involves representing ownership of these assets as digital tokens on a blockchain. This makes them more accessible, liquid, and transparent. For example, a piece of real estate can be tokenized, allowing multiple people to own a fraction of it.
  • **Layer-2 Scaling Solutions:** Ethereum is a powerful blockchain, but it can sometimes be slow and expensive to use, especially during peak times. Layer-2 solutions, like Polygon and Arbitrum, are built on top of Ethereum to handle transactions more efficiently and at a lower cost. Think of it like adding extra lanes to a highway to ease congestion.
  • **Decentralized Finance (DeFi) 2.0 & 3.0:** DeFi aims to recreate traditional financial services – like lending and borrowing – in a decentralized way. DeFi 2.0 addressed initial challenges around liquidity and sustainability, while DeFi 3.0 focuses on greater capital efficiency and cross-chain interoperability.
  • **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Crypto:** The intersection of AI and crypto is generating a lot of buzz. AI can be used to improve trading algorithms, enhance security, and create new decentralized applications. Projects are emerging that use AI to analyze market data and identify potential trading opportunities.
  • **Memecoins & Community-Driven Projects:** While often volatile, memecoins like Dogecoin and Shiba Inu have demonstrated the power of online communities in the crypto space. These coins often gain popularity through social media and viral trends.
  • **Restaking:** Restaking allows users to stake their existing staked ETH (or other assets) to secure other protocols, earning additional rewards. This is a relatively new trend gaining traction in the Ethereum ecosystem.

Comparing Layer-1 vs. Layer-2 Solutions

Understanding the difference between these foundational layers is important.

Layer-1 Layer-2
The base blockchain (e.g., Ethereum, Bitcoin). Built on top of a Layer-1 blockchain.
Handles all transactions directly. Processes transactions off-chain (separately) before settling on Layer-1.
Generally slower and more expensive. Faster and cheaper.
More secure (typically). Security relies on the underlying Layer-1.

Risk Management

The crypto market is highly volatile. Always practice responsible risk management:

  • **Set Stop-Loss Orders:** Automatically sell your assets if the price falls to a certain level.
  • **Take Profits:** Secure your gains by selling when the price reaches a target level.
  • **Use Position Sizing:** Don't risk more than a small percentage of your capital on any single trade.
  • **Understand Market Capitalization**: Smaller cap coins are inherently riskier.
